Which of these is a prime number?
733
712
702
725

Respuesta :

mathstudent55
mathstudent55 mathstudent55
  • 11-11-2020

Answer:

733

Step-by-step explanation:

712 and 702 end in 2, so they're divisible by 2.

725 ends in 5, so it's divisible by 5.

733 is not divisible by 2.

7 + 3 + 3 = 13, so 733 is not divisible by 3.

It looks like 733 is the prime number.
